Gaddafi ready to step down

Tripoli, July 13: Muammar Gaddafi, the notorious leader who refused to quit and threw his country in civil war, is ready to step down, France’s foreign minister, Alain Juppe said citing his emmissaries.

It is not immediately clear if the offer is credible or whether it amounts to a potential breakthrough in the Libyan crisis.

In public statements up until now, Gaddafi has refused to leave or give up power. Juppe admits that the contacts do not constitute proper negotiations, but France has long insisted that Gaddafi giving up power is key to ending the hostilities.
